Job Description: BI Developer (Tableau + Power BI)
Location: India (Remote/Hybrid)
Experience: 4–8 years
CTC: ₹6 – 8 LPA
Location: India (All GWC Office Locations)
Employment Type: Full Time (No Remote)
Role Overview
We are looking for a strong BI Developer with end-to-end expertise in Tableau and Power BI, excellent analytical and communication skills, and hands-on experience working directly with US clients. The ideal candidate can independently gather requirements, design dashboards, build scalable data models, optimize performance, and manage deployment/governance.
A strong foundation in SQL is mandatory, and experience in data engineering or data warehouse implementation is an added advantage.
Key Responsibilities
Tableau (Primary Skill)
- Full-cycle dashboard development: requirements, wireframing, design, calculations, and publishing.
- Strong hands-on experience with Tableau Cloud, Tableau Server, Tableau Prep, and Admin activities (projects, permissions, extracts, schedules).
- Performance optimization: reducing workbook load time, optimizing extracts, and best-practice calculations.
- Experience in governance: usage analytics, migration activities, site structure, version upgrades.
- Direct exposure working with US-based business stakeholders.
Power BI
- Expert in Power Query (M Query) transformations.
- Strong data modeling skills: star schema, relationships, normalization.
- Hands-on expertise in DAX, including time intelligence and performance optimization.
- Experience with Power BI Service: workspaces, refresh scheduling, gateways, RLS, and deployment pipelines.
SQL (Mandatory)
- Strong SQL skills across complex joins, window functions, aggregations, and query optimization.
- Ability to validate dashboard logic and debug data discrepancies directly using SQL.
Business Analyst & Client Interaction
- Requirement gathering, client workshops, UAT support, and end-user demos.
- Strong communication skills, especially working with US clients.
- Ability to translate ambiguous business needs into clear BI specifications.
Data Engineering & Data Warehouse (Added Advantage)
- Understanding of data warehousing concepts (fact/dimension models, SCDs, schemas).
- Exposure to building or contributing to data pipelines using SQL, ETL tools, or cloud platforms.
- Experience in implementing or supporting data warehouse solutions (Snowflake, Redshift, BigQuery, SQL Server DW, etc.).
- Familiarity with data integration workflows, incremental loads, scheduling, and data quality checks.
Nice-to-Have
- Exposure to ETL tools: Tableau Prep, Power BI Dataflows, SSIS, Alteryx, Domo Magic ETL, etc.
- Experience with AWS, Azure, or GCP.
- Understanding of governance frameworks, deployment best practices, and BI center-of-excellence processes.
What We Expect
- Ownership mindset — ability to take a requirement from concept to production.
- Strong visualization sense and dashboard storytelling ability.
- Ability to manage multiple deliverables in fast-paced client-facing environments.
- Proactive, structured communication and on-time delivery.
Qualification
- Bachelor’s/Master’s in Computer Science, IT, Data Analytics, or related fields.
4–8 years of experience in BI development with strong global client interaction
